/**
* Returns the effective key to be used for property lookup via one of the getProperty(...) methods.
* <p>
* When looking up a key, "password" for example, the following effective keys are tried, in this order:
* <ol>
* <li>the test user name plus simple key, e.g. "TAuthor.password"</li>
* <li>the test class name plus simple key, e.g. "com.xceptance.xlt.samples.tests.TAuthor.password"</li>
* <li>the simple key, e.g. "password"</li>
* </ol>
*
* @param bareKey
* the bare property key, i.e. without any prefixes
* @return the first key that produces a result
*/
protected String getEffectiveKey(final String bareKey)
{
final String effectiveKey;
// 1. use the current user name as prefix
final String userNameQualifiedKey = this.testName + "." + bareKey;
if (this.xltProperties.containsKey(userNameQualifiedKey))
{
effectiveKey = userNameQualifiedKey;
}
else
{
// 2. use the current class name as prefix
final String classNameQualifiedKey = this.fullTestCaseName + "." + bareKey;
if (this.xltProperties.containsKey(classNameQualifiedKey))
{
effectiveKey = classNameQualifiedKey;
}
else
{
// 3. use the bare key
effectiveKey = bareKey;
}
}
return effectiveKey;
}
